What is the purpose of a music video

What is a music video?

A music video is a short film or video that accompanies a complete piece of music/song. Music videos use a wide range of styles of film making techniques, including animation, live action filming, documentaries, and non-narrative approaches such as abstract film. Some music videos blend different styles, such as animation and live action.

What is the purpose of a music video?

The Purpose of a Music Video is to accompany a song and be used as a device for promotion of the artist, the sale of music records and other merchandise.

Music Videos use a wide range of film making techniques and use various different styles:
  • Narrative
  • Abstract
  • Animation
  • Live Action
  • Documentary
You can also have a mixture of a few of these key styles, through this music videos are able to explore lots of different stylistic features.

Styles may vary depending on the style. For example live action from concert gigs may be used more by acoustic artists and more narrative story lines for r 'n' b and rap videos.
